I returned mine and I really wanted to love it. The biggest issue was it didn't control frizz and make my hair smooth enough not to have to go over with a flat iron (and I tried different products, different heat settings, tried it wet & dry, for 3 1/2 weeks). Pre-drying the roots made it frizzier for me. It worked better if I sectioned my hair and pre-dried each section. My goal was to limit heat and if I have to use a flat iron anyway, I get a better result with my T3 on a lower heat and my flat iron. For reference my hair is naturally silver, fine texture and thick density.

As someone who used Lashify for a year and recently switched over to Lilac St. I will say Lilac st lashes are actually way more comfortable and stay on longer. I gave lashify a good run and I loved them but I found that the lilac st lashes seemed sturdier and so comfortable. Plus, you cant beat the price point. I even like their glue a lot more. I actually do a small swipe of glue by the lash line and use a makeup brush and brush the glue up my lashes and apply. They last over a week no problem and stay looking great! No regrets moving to lilac st!
